Output 28b4b295d8d072286f9d2693cf21dc6145aa5fb65ede47544ea17e1bfb25e23b:3

value
628117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d8e8f18542a7288d3186abc15f2819541d0f34e OP_EQUAL
address
37JVvR5Vb3mApPmxBjA1dysTzRT71fZk3X
transaction
28b4b295d8d072286f9d2693cf21dc6145aa5fb65ede47544ea17e1bfb25e23b
spent
true